> Penny said, 'and you remember those Garçons de 71, I expect.' ..."
> (AtD, Pt. I, Ch. 2, p. 19)
And a few sentences later, "When the siege ended, these balloonists chose to
fly on, free of the political delusions that reigned more than ever on the
ground". I took the Garçons de 71 as a reference to the Paris Commune, and
another part of the anarchist theme.
